Call for Abstracts: Joint Spring Meeting “The Power of Where - Spatial Insights from Survey Data”

The two-day spring meeting „The Power of Where: Spatial Insights from Survey Data“ will take place in person at Brandenburg University of Technology in Cottbus on February 29 to March 1, 2024. The meeting is jointly organized by the Bundesinstitut für Bau-, Stadt- und Raumforschung (BBSR), Brandenburg University of Technology (BTU), and SOEP-RegioHub at Bielefeld University and is conceived as a lunch-to-lunch event.
Invited are scholars who combine spatial and survey data to present research stemming from a broad range of disciplines, including geography, sociology, economics, planning, and political science. Contributions can range from presentations of empirical findings to theoretical reflections and methodological discussions (e.g., data linkage challenges or mapping techniques). The workshop aims to facilitate a constructive exchange of ideas, and we particularly encourage doctoral candidates and young scholars to present the current state of their research.
Abstracts of no longer than 300 words should be submitted to Daniel Meyer by November 15, 2023. Applicants will receive a notification of acceptance by November 30, 2023.
